Data types of columns pandas

WebApr 10, 2024 · Polars and arrow rely on strict data types so ultimately, yes, it's a limitation. You can never have a column that is sometimes Utf8 and sometimes Floatxx. Pandas, on the other hand, is happy to have a column of mixed data types because it's basically just a python list. Share Improve this answer Follow answered 2 days ago Dean MacGregor WebFor example: When summing data, NA (missing) values will be treated as zero. If the data are all NA, the result will be 0. Cumulative methods like cumsum () and cumprod () ignore NA values by default, but preserve them in the resulting arrays. To override this behaviour and include NA values, use skipna=False.

How to Convert to Best Data Types Automatically in Pandas?

WebSep 15, 2015 · In case if you are not aware of the number and name of columns in dataframe then this method can be handy: column_list = [] df_column = pd.read_excel (file_name, 'Sheet1').columns for i in df_column: column_list.append (i) converter = {col: str for col in column_list} df_actual = pd.read_excel (file_name, converters=converter) WebApr 23, 2024 · 3 Answers. You can use df.astype () with a dictionary for the columns you want to change with the corresponding dtype. To change the dtypes of all float64 … lite beer carbs https://privusclothing.com

Change the data type of a column or a Pandas Series

WebApr 11, 2024 · Return the dtypes in the dataframe. this returns a series with the data type of each column. the result’s index is the original dataframe’s columns. columns with … Web2 days ago · and there is a 'Unique Key' variable which is assigned to each complaint. Please help me with the proper codes. df_new=df.pivot_table (index='Complaint Type',columns='City',values='Unique Key') df_new i did this and worked but is there any other way to do it as it is not clear to me python pandas Share Follow asked 51 secs ago … WebJan 6, 2024 · You can use the following basic syntax to specify the dtype of each column in a DataFrame when importing a CSV file into pandas: df = pd.read_csv('my_data.csv', … lite beer tastes great less filling

Change the data type of a column or a Pandas Series

Category:python - Selecting Pandas Columns by dtype - Stack Overflow

Tags:Data types of columns pandas

Data types of columns pandas

Get Count Of Dtypes In A Pandas Dataframe Data Science Parichay

WebApr 11, 2024 · Return the dtypes in the dataframe. this returns a series with the data type of each column. the result’s index is the original dataframe’s columns. columns with mixed types are stored with the object dtype. see the user guide for more. returns pandas.series the data type of each column. examples >>>. WebApr 21, 2024 · This answer contains a very elegant way of setting all the types of your pandas columns in one line: # convert column "a" to int64 dtype and "b" to complex type df = df.astype ( {"a": int, "b": complex})

Data types of columns pandas

Did you know?

WebMay 15, 2024 · This approach uses pandas.api.types.infer_dtype to find the columns which have mixed dtypes. It was tested with Pandas 1 under Python 3.8. ... To fix the … WebJan 6, 2024 · You can use the following basic syntax to specify the dtype of each column in a DataFrame when importing a CSV file into pandas: df = pd.read_csv('my_data.csv', dtype = {'col1': str, 'col2': float, 'col3': int}) The dtype argument specifies the data type that each column should have when importing the CSV file into a pandas DataFrame.

Webpandas.DataFrame.shape pandas.DataFrame.memory_usage pandas.DataFrame.empty pandas.DataFrame.set_flags pandas.DataFrame.astype pandas.DataFrame.convert_dtypes pandas.DataFrame.infer_objects pandas.DataFrame.copy pandas.DataFrame.bool … pandas.DataFrame.groupby# DataFrame. groupby (by = None, axis = 0, level = … pandas.DataFrame.columns pandas.DataFrame.dtypes … Use a str, numpy.dtype, pandas.ExtensionDtype or Python type … pandas arrays, scalars, and data types Index objects Date offsets Window … A DataFrame with mixed type columns(e.g., str/object, int64, float32) results in an … This method prints information about a DataFrame including the index dtype … pandas.DataFrame.drop# DataFrame. drop (labels = None, *, axis = 0, index = … pandas.DataFrame.hist# DataFrame. hist (column = None, by = None, grid = True, … columns dict-like or function. Alternative to specifying axis (mapper, axis=1 is … Notes. agg is an alias for aggregate.Use the alias. Functions that mutate the passed … WebJan 22, 2014 · In version 0.24.+ pandas has gained the ability to hold integer dtypes with missing values. Nullable Integer Data Type.. Pandas can represent integer data with …

WebSep 8, 2024 · This method returns a list of data types for each column or also returns just a data type of a particular column Example 1: Python3 df.dtypes Output: Example 2: Python3 df.Cust_No.dtypes Output: dtype ('int64') Example 3: Python3 df ['Product_cost'].dtypes Output: dtype ('float64') Check the Data Type in Pandas using … WebNov 1, 2016 · The singular form dtype is used to check the data type for a single column. And the plural form dtypes is for data frame which returns data types for all columns. …

WebJul 22, 2024 · df1.info() Int64Index: 873353 entries, 0 to 873352 Data columns (total 2 columns): Customer_ID 873353 non-null object Flag …

WebJul 28, 2024 · Get the data type of column in Pandas – Python. Name of columns. Data type of columns. Rows in Dataframe. non-null entries in each column. It will also print … lite beton atlantaWebwhile working with data types, they should be passed as strings. For example the latter method you followed should be modified as mydf = pd.DataFrame (myarray,columns= ['a','b'], dtype= {'a': 'int'}) instead of mydf = pd.DataFrame (myarray,columns= ['a','b'], dtype= {'a': int}). The dtype (int, float etc.) should be given as strings. lite beton bostonWebJan 28, 2024 · This should work with any operation even if it doesn't support specifying on which columns to work. Example input: df = pd.DataFrame ( {'col1': list ('ABC'), 'col2': list ('123'), 'col3': list ('456'), }) output: >>> df.dtypes col1 object col2 float64 col3 float64 dtype: object Share Improve this answer Follow answered Jan 28, 2024 at 12:29 lite beer from miller caloriesWebDec 2, 2024 · In pandas datatype by default are int, float and objects. When we load or create any series or dataframe in pandas, pandas by default assigns the necessary datatype to columns and series. We will use pandas convert_dtypes () function to convert the default assigned data-types to the best datatype automatically. lite bianca berlinguerWebOct 13, 2024 · Let’s see How To Change Column Type in Pandas DataFrames, There are different ways of changing DataType for one or more columns in Pandas Dataframe. Change column type into string object using DataFrame.astype() DataFrame.astype() method is used to cast pandas object to a specified dtype. This function also provides … lite beer vs regular beer caloriesWebMar 26, 2024 · In order to convert data types in pandas, there are three basic options: Use astype () to force an appropriate dtype Create a custom function to convert the data Use pandas functions such as to_numeric () … imperial sovereign court of portlandWebTo get the dtype of a specific column, you have two ways: Use DataFrame.dtypes which returns a Series whose index is the column header. $ df.dtypes.loc ['v'] bool. Use … imperial sovereign gem court of idaho